What Is Digital Marketing
Digital marketing is the practice of promoting products or services using online channels and digital technologies — basically, any marketing that happens on the internet.
It helps businesses reach people where they spend most of their time — online: on search engines, social media, email, websites, and mobile apps.
🌐 Definition
Digital Marketing = using digital platforms (like Google, Facebook, Instagram, YouTube, and websites) to:
-
attract customers,
-
build brand awareness,
-
and drive sales or leads.
🎯 Main Types of Digital Marketing
-
Search Engine Optimization (SEO)
→ Optimizing your website to rank higher on Google and get free traffic.
Example: Appearing on page 1 when someone searches “best pizza near me.” -
Search Engine Marketing (SEM) / Pay-Per-Click (PPC)
→ Paid ads on Google (Google Ads). You pay only when someone clicks your ad. -
Social Media Marketing (SMM)
→ Promoting your brand or products on platforms like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, LinkedIn, etc.
Example: Running sponsored posts or engaging with followers. -
Content Marketing
→ Creating valuable content (blogs, videos, guides) to attract and educate your audience.
Example: A fitness brand posting workout tutorials on YouTube. -
Email Marketing
→ Sending personalized emails to build relationships and encourage purchases.
Example: Newsletters, product updates, or discount offers. -
Affiliate Marketing
→ Partnering with others (influencers, bloggers) who promote your products for a commission. -
Influencer Marketing
→ Working with social media influencers to promote your brand. -
Mobile Marketing
→ Reaching users through apps, SMS, or mobile ads. -
Video Marketing
→ Using videos (on YouTube, TikTok, or Reels) to showcase products or stories.
⚙️ How Digital Marketing Works
-
Attract – Get people’s attention online through SEO, ads, or social media.
-
Engage – Share useful or interesting content to build trust.
-
Convert – Encourage people to take action (buy, sign up, contact you).
-
Retain – Stay connected with customers through emails or loyalty programs.

💡 Example
Let’s say you own a clothing store:
-
You run Google Ads so people find your site when they search “summer dresses.”
-
You post outfit ideas on Instagram and tag products.
-
You email subscribers a discount code for new arrivals.
All of this together is digital marketing.
